Hulu live crashing to Home Screen

Hulu Live TV keeps crashing to the home screen on all my devices, regardless of the device. My internet connection is fiber at 500 Mbps, and I’ve tried all the basic troubleshooting steps, including updating the app, the Apple TV, deleting the app and reinstalling it, power cycling the Apple TV and modem/router. Unfortunately, none of these solutions have resolved the issue. The duration of the crashes varies randomly, ranging from an hour to 3 hours, and sometimes only lasting 20 minutes. Despite these attempts, the crashes persist. Notably, this issue is specific to Hulu Live Broadcast and doesn’t occur with any other app or even Hulu’s non-live content. The problem has been observed on all three Apple TVs I have. I don’t know why it says tvOS 18, I am on tvOS 26.1 (23J582). The Hulu app version is 9.20.0-released nov 2 2025, and the crashing started a week or so ago. Before that, it only happened a couple of times a week.
